News summary

The Seattle Mariners have made several roster moves, including placing Dylan Moore on the 10-day injured list due to right hip inflammation and transferring Gregory Santos to the 60-day injured list with right knee inflammation. In response, the team has selected infielder/outfielder Samad Taylor from Triple-A Tacoma, where he has been performing well, batting .321 with five home runs in 24 games. Moore, who was recently named American League Player of the Week, has been a key contributor this season. Additionally, pitcher Tayler Saucedo was recalled from Triple-A Tacoma to bolster the bullpen in light of Logan Gilbert's injury but was quickly optioned back after a scoreless inning in a 14-0 win. These roster adjustments aim to address injuries and maintain depth as the Mariners navigate the season.
